Subject: Quickstore 4.2 — bloom filter now fronts the KV layer

Plugin authors: starting with this release, Quickstore places a bloom filter ahead of the key-value store. Negative lookups return faster; false positives fall through safely. No API changes are required on your side. Verify your plugin against the staging build referenced below.

session token of fahif-tadup = htk3_9c7

First-aid room. The first-aid room at Pellinore Works is on the ground floor of the north wing, next to the post room. It is stocked with standard supplies and a defibrillator, and the duty first aiders are listed on the noticeboard outside. The room is kept locked when not in use. If a first aider is not immediately available, you can open the door with the code below.

turnstile pass: bdg-TXR-4

Quilverton Systems plans net growth of 42 roles next year, concentrated in engineering and field support for the Larkspur platform. Attrition assumptions remain at current levels. Hiring in the Dremwick office will pause until the lease renewal is settled; remote hires will backfill critical gaps. Compensation budgets were reviewed by Petra Halling and hold within the approved envelope. The board should note that sequencing depends on first-half bookings. The confidential staffing rationale tied to our business plans appears below.

confidential, kagep-kahof: Druokax Systems plans to lower the Ulaath list price by 53 percent in March.